Power, voltage, and size—kept simple
At 1600W on 277V, this lamp packs a lot of punch into a 499mm (19.6-inch) tube. That 277V rating is a practical win, because it matches common three-phase setups in commercial and industrial buildings. So you can wire it in without messing around with step-down transformers. The longer length helps, too. It spreads the heat across a wider zone, which can make it easier to match the time your product spends under the lamp—whether you’re running a conveyor or using a fixed drying rack. Here’s the part to keep in mind: 1600W in a half-meter tube means a lot of radiant heat. That’s exactly what you want for drying, but it also means your machine’s ventilation and thermal design need to be up to the task. If airflow and reflector sizing are off, you’ll run into overheating—and that shortens lamp life.
What’s inside—and why it stays steady
Inside, you’ve got a halogen infrared element inside a clear quartz envelope. The clear finish lets the infrared through cleanly, and the halogen cycle does its job by putting evaporated filament material back onto the filament. That helps keep output consistent and fights the usual drop-off you get over time. Then there’s the R7S base. It’s a double-ended linear connector that holds tight mechanically and keeps a solid electrical connection even when things are vibrating. And because it’s a standard R7S fit, swapping a lamp is quick—less downtime when you’re trying to keep the line moving.
Real-world use on the shop floor
In Serigrafia Textil, you need heat that hits fast and even, so inks flash-dry without scorching the fabric. The infrared from this halogen lamp gets right into the ink layer, driving off solvents and setting the print quickly. The 499mm length gives you a broad heating zone, so you can cover more without stacking a bunch of smaller emitters. On the practical side, the 277V supply makes wiring in industrial panels simpler, and the R7S interface keeps installation consistent. You get predictable performance, straightforward maintenance, and a form factor that fits compact dryers. Just remember: high power density means you need to plan for cooling and clearance. Treat the thermal side with respect, and this lamp will do its job—day after day.
